Hank Azaria


Henry Albert Hank Azaria is an American actor, voice actor, comedian and producer. He is known for starring in the animated television sitcom The Simpsons , voicing Moe Szyslak, Apu Nahasapeemapetilon, Chief Wiggum, Comic Book Guy, Carl Carlson and numerous others. After attending Tufts University, Azaria joined the series with little voice acting experience, but became a regular in its second season, with many of his performances on the show being based on famous actors and characters.

Azaria was born in Queens, New York City, the son of Sephardic Jewish parents, Ruth and Albert Azaria. His grandparents on both sides hailed from Thessaloniki, Greece, and his family spoke Ladino. Azarias father ran several dressmanufacturing businesses, while his mother raised him and his two older sisters, Stephanie and Elise. Before marrying his father, Azarias mother had been a publicist for Columbia Pictures, promoting films in Latin American countries, as she was fluent in both English and Spanish. During his childhood, Azaria often memorize and mimic the scripts of the films, shows and standup comedy routines that he enjoyed.
